This week I have the you the Classic Champagne Cocktail, a recipe dating back to the 1860’s, but was quite popular during the 1940’s and 1950’s. This drink if referenced quite frequently in classic films with just a couple that come to mind including Casablanca (1942), and Lured (1947) starring Lucille Ball.
